Meritor Wabco hosts NTSB chairman for safety demonstration

Updated Jul 7, 2011

WabcoMeritor Wabco Vehicle Control Systems hosted the Honorable Deborah A.P. Hersman, chairman of the National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B), on June 28 at the company’s Michigan Proving Ground in Romeo, Mich.

Chairman Hersman and NTSB staff experienced demonstrations of Meritor Wabco’s active safety technologies. Vehicle demonstrations included antilock braking systems (ABS), SmartTrac stability control system, OnGuard collision safety system and SafetyDirect fleet performance system, the company says.

“Our advanced safety systems continue to assist drivers in potentially avoiding accidents and increasing highway safety overall,” says Jon Morrison, president and general manager, Meritor Wabco. “It’s an honor to share our safety systems with Chairman Hersman and others from NTSB.”

The NTSB is an independent U.S. Federal agency that investigates and studies transportation accidents in the United States to provide safety recommendations for future accident prevention.

According to Wabco, the SmartTrac stability control systems is a suite of active safety systems that assist the driver in maintaining control of the vehicle in response to an impending loss of directional control or roll instability, reducing the risk of such events. The OnGuard collision safety system is said to be a forward-looking radar-based collision safety system that detects objects in a vehicle’s path and when appropriate automatically de-throttles the engine and applies the engine and service brakes when it senses a possible rear-end collision. The SafetyDirect fleet performance system is a Web-based reporting tool that Wabco says uses an onboard data logger to capture and report driving behavior, vehicle characteristics and severe events.
